Usview.cite-web.com Pay Online: How to Pay Your Camera Ticket

Toll Bill

You can pay many red‑light and speed camera citations online at usview.cite-web.com using the citation number and PIN from your mailed notice, for cities like Albuquerque, Philadelphia, Rockville, Takoma Park, Napa, and parts of Delaware.

Step‑by‑Step: Pay at usview.cite-web.com

  1. Go to https://usview.cite-web.com (type it in or use the exact link/QR on your paper notice).
  2. Enter:
    • Your Citation/Notice Number (including any letters like “ABQ‑‑”, “RL”, etc.).
    • Your PIN/Password from the notice.
  3. Click Login / View Citation to see your violation details, photos, and video.
  4. Choose Pay and complete payment with a major credit or debit card (most sites accept Visa, Mastercard, and Discover).

Many jurisdictions add a convenience/processing fee (for example, around 4–5% or a flat amount such as 4.00 USD) on online card payments.

Phone, Mail, and Payment Plans

If you can’t or don’t want to pay online:

  • Phone: Many programs list a customer service/pay‑by‑phone number (for example, Albuquerque ASE: 844‑652‑0888 for “ABQ‑‑” citations) for credit/debit or ACH payments.
  • Mail:
    • Use the return stub on your notice.
    • Mail a check or money order (no cash) to the exact address on the citation (e.g., “Automated Speed Enforcement Program” or similar).
    • Write your citation number and license plate on the payment.
  • Payment plans: Some agencies (e.g., Albuquerque, Delaware) allow partial payment plans if requested on time; the notice or local website explains how to apply.

Security and Scam Warnings

  • Legitimate use: usview.cite-web.com is a contracted portal referenced on official .gov pages in Albuquerque, Philadelphia, Delaware, Rockville, etc.
  • Only trust it if:
    • The URL exactly matches what is printed on a mailed notice.
    • The notice comes from a known government agency (city, county, DOT).
  • Do NOT trust:
    • Text messages or random emails with links claiming you owe a camera fine; cities repeatedly warn that they do not send citation notices or payment links by text.

If in doubt, go to your city’s official .gov site, find the “Pay red‑light/speed camera ticket” page, and follow the link from there (it should point to usview.cite-web.com or another named portal).


Quick FAQs

1. What do I need to pay online at usview.cite-web.com?
Your citation/notice number (with letters like RL or ABQ‑‑ if present) and the PIN/password from your mailed notice.

2. What if I lost my PIN or notice?
Check your city or state’s automated enforcement page for instructions; many tell you to call a customer service number (for example, Albuquerque: 844‑652‑0888; Delaware: Elovate at 844‑213‑7033) to look up your citation and payment options.

3. Will I be charged an extra fee online?
Yes, most programs add a convenience or processing fee (flat or percentage) to cover card processing costs.

4. How do I know it’s not a fake site?
Confirm that (a) your paper citation and your city’s .gov website both list usview.cite-web.com as the payment portal and (b) the ticket details (plate, date, location) match your vehicle.
